Let A is centre of small circle of radius 3 cm . Let B is centre of circle of radius 6 cm .
Let C be the centre of circle that just encloses the circles of radii 3cm and 6 cm as shown in figure.
Common tangent KL make contact with circles at D and E.
Hence if we draw lines AD and BE , these lines are perpendicular to KL.
Let us draw a perpendicular line CF from C to KL.
In ΔXBE, we have AD | | BE . Hence we have
From above expression, we get , XA = AB = 9 cm
In ΔXCF, we have AD | | CF . Hence we have
Hence we get , CF = (5/3) AD = (5/3) × 3 = 5 cm
Since CF is perpendicular to the chord KL , we get
KL = 2 KF = 15 cm
